Peaky Blinders style continues to influence modern menswear, and at the New York premiere of Peaky Blinders: The Immortal Man, actor Cillian Murphy demonstrated how classic accessories such as antique stick pins remain an elegant part of gentleman’s fashion.
At the New York premiere of Peaky Blinders: The Immortal Man, actor Cillian Murphy appeared wearing an antique stick pin lent by DSF Antique Jewelry.
The elegant jewel — a French 18K gold stick pin set with onyx and rose-cut diamonds — reflects the refined accessories that once defined the wardrobe of the late nineteenth-century gentleman. Small yet distinctive, such pieces were traditionally worn in cravats or ties and served as subtle markers of personal style.
